A longtime Texarkana business is going out of business.

Going Out of Business - Liquidation Sale

Hank's Fine Furniture located at 502 Walton Drive will be shutting its doors for good soon! Hank's has been a Texarkana fixture for 39 years and starting on Saturday at 9 AM the store will begin a huge liquidation sale everything must go from living and dining room furniture to bedroom furniture, brand-name mattresses, lamps, and mirrors. decorative home decor and more. Everything has been drastically slashed so if you want a good deal now is the time because when it's gone it's gone for good. Hank's was independently owned.

History of Hank's Fine Furniture

The late Hank Browne founded the chain of furniture stores in the 1980s with locations in Fort Smith, Russellville, and North Little Rock. The stores started as Freight Sales Furniture Stores before they became known as Hank's Discount Fine Furniture in 1995 and were later shortened to Hank's Fine Furniture. Sad to say, but Mr. Browne passed away in December 2022, before his passing his stores grew to 18 locations in the four states. He was committed to several charitable organizations and was an avid supporter of conservation as well. Hank Browne was a native of Ponca, Oklahoma, and grew up in Arkansas he was a former military veteran with the U.S. Navy, Browne was 82 years old at the time of his death.
